Program Overview
Program Overview
The Master's of Science program in Biomedical Engineering is an interdisciplinary course of study involving interaction between the natural sciences, medicine, and engineering. The program provides a high level of education in close cooperation with clinics and industry.
Program Structure
- The program involves many faculties: Medicine; Mathematics, Computer Science, and Natural Sciences; Mechanical Engineering; Arts and Humanities; and Electrical Engineering and Information Technology.
- The program is designed to be completed in four semesters.
- Courses are held in small groups, with some modules having no more than 30 students.
Curriculum
- The first semester includes courses in natural science, engineering, and medicine, such as physiology and anatomy.
- The second and third semesters cover the main focus areas: imaging and image-guided therapy, artificial organs, and tissue engineering.
- The curriculum also includes the teaching of platform technologies such as systems biology and medical imaging.
- The Master's thesis is completed during the fourth semester.
Career Opportunities
- Biomedical Engineering graduates have a wide range of job opportunities:
- Hospital (research, development, technology management, radiology, safety engineer)
- Industry (research, development, quality management, consulting, training, sales, regulatory affairs and inspection services)
- Public authorities: Administration (e.g., TÜV), expert organisations (e.g., radiation protection), health service
- The program also provides opportunities to pursue PhD programs at universities both in Germany and abroad.
Program Details
- The program is an English-language course of study.
- RWTH Aachen University welcomes students from all over the world and different courses of study to increase their knowledge in Biomedical Engineering.
- The program has a deeper focus on biomedical applications compared to many other programs in Biomedical Engineering at other universities.
